News coming out of Brazil is confirming what we sadly already knew.
Young winger Estevao is not going to the World Cup with Brazil. Ge Globo have today reported that he wonât be on the list of 55 names in the preliminary squad for the Selecao.
After tearing his hamstring against Manchester United last month, the teenager tried his best for a miracle recovery which never seemed likely. The tournament is now just a month away, and Carlo Ancelotti wonât be counting on him.
Frankly, weâre much more concerned with Estevaoâs long term health than his World Cup chances. From the moment the word came out that his issue was serious, weâd written off his chances of going.
Reports that this was a serious tear which could affect his speed and agility long term are far more concerning. As sad as he might be right now, he needs to focus on his rehab to make sure to limit the damage as much as possible.
